febbraio 2007 Blog Posts
anche se in effetti nell'angolo in basso a sinistra io avrei un'idea di quale sito tenere aperto ma per questioni decenza non lo posso dire...:-)
Qualche altra news al blog ufficiale del team di ADO.NET...In Orcas verrà introdotto un nuovo data provider (EntityClient) per fornire un gateway per le query fatte sulle Entity.Questo client utilizzerà un suo linguaggio definito (Entity SQL) e saranno disponibili i soliti Connection, Command, Parameter, e DataReader tanto cari a tutti i membri della famiglia dei dataprovider .net come SqlClient, OracleClient etc. La tendenza sembra per ora la stessa: Linq for SQL, Linq for Entities, come questo provider non gestiscono in modo automatico i DML (Data Manipulation Language) sul Db. Niente insert/update/delete. In pratica coprono solo la parte della interrogazione pura. Ok...viene...
Manca poco più di un mese al corso "Mastering NHibernate"...Oggi ho appreso che Objectway effettuerà uno sconto del 10% sulla quota di iscrizione (che per altro è già bassa) per tutti i soci Ugidotnet... Sto aggiornando un po di materiale, e devo dire che tra tutti i vari metodi di Retrieve sugli oggetti (QbC, QbE, HQL, Query SQL), probabilmente punterò quasi tutto su HQL, con una modalità di disegno del persistence context piuttosto particolare, che prevederà un upgrade indolore a Linq [occhio che ho detto Linq e non DLinq...:-)...] Ovviamente un grazie va a tutta Ugi per il benefit...allora, forza...
Ieri Ricky ha tenuto il secondo webcast della serie "Aspire" per Guisa, il cui argomento era tra l'altro tra i miei preferiti in assoluto, "i Principi di Design". Per chi si volesse divertire, vi consiglio di scaricarlo...per fare conoscenza con l'Open Closed, Liskov,e compagnia bella. Sono i principi basilari di progettazione che hanno portato alla formulazione dei Design Pattern così come li conosciamo. Io non l'ho potuto vedere in diretta, ma tanto la sera prima eravamo a casa mia, con Ricky e Daniele, davanti a una pizza di 16 metri di diametro a chiacchierarci su...:-) Settimana prossima invece tocca a...
Jeremy Miller, che rimane uno dei miei blogger preferiti, ha scritto una piccola nota (rifacendosi anche ad un capitolo del libro di Eric Evans, Domain Driven Design) sui problemi generati dall'uso di chiavi composite nel db. Sembra impossibile come si siano potuti disegnare database per anni e anni in questo modo. Le chiavi composite, oggettivamente creano non poche rogne, quando potete (quando avete le mani libere)...usate chiavi surrogate.Programmare per credere. Source: Composite keys are evil Originally published on Thu, 01 Feb 2007 15:05:00 GMT by jmiller
Il principio di Hollywood è una definizione un po goliardica del principio di Inversione di Controllo che dice più o meno così:Non chiamarmi, ti chiamo io...Per sottolineare il fatto che un oggetto non deve costruirsi da solo ma deve essere costruito da una factory. Oggi pomeriggio abbiamo formalizzato il "Principio di Janky e Lorenzo" applicabile a tutte le ragazze well-formed, che recita:Non preoccuparti...ti chiamo io!Ogni commento è superfluo.
premesso che questo post lo dovevo scrivere almeno qualche settimana fa...però...ne approfitto visto che ieri mi è arrivato un "pacco" a casa...Questi sono i regali che ci siamo scambiati a natale io e il "pres"...Quello di sinistra è un mvp invite per una licenza di msdn team suite, quella di destra è una coppia di conserve contenenti pomodorini secchi siciliani, con basilico e olio di casa, tutto fatto in casa.Secondo voi chi ci ha guadagnato?
Sono state pubblicate su Guisa le slide del webcast sulla Domain Driven Design...Ecco il link...